Output 32767d7d21a07760f86f8f60d3cfefb643a7697a0759512e1cb6351b8d0f855a:8

value
6884749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8021f22dbcf5081e153b85ecdc9519f9f4e94037 OP_EQUAL
address
3DNX5i2dxS3GPHtcpi4j4SiN8RLmPtXro6
transaction
32767d7d21a07760f86f8f60d3cfefb643a7697a0759512e1cb6351b8d0f855a
confirmations
352677
spent
true